The Prime Minister, Shri Narendra Modi participated in a program marking ‘Veer Bal Diwas’ at Bharat Mandapam, New Delhi today and witnessed a recital and three martial arts displays performed by children. Addressing the gathering, the Hon’ble Prime Minister remarked that the nation is remembering the immortal sacrifices of Veer Sahibzade and deriving inspiration from them as a new chapter of Veer Bal Diwas unfolds for India in the Azadi Ka Amrit Kaal. Students & teachers in huge numbers watched the live telecast of the programme.

The wholehearted engagement of educational institutions and schools on Veer Baal Diwas created a collective sense of pride and unity & reinforced the importance of remembering and honoring such acts for future generations.

Last year, Government of India had decided to commemorate 26th December every year as “Veer Baal Diwas” to pay homage to the great valour and supreme sacrifice of Sahibzada Zorawar Singh Ji and Sahibzada Fateh Singh Ji , the younger sons of the tenth Sikh Guru Gobind Singh ji.

In order to commemorate Veer Baal Diwas 2023, various interactive and participative programswere conducted during the run up to the day in all schools of States/UTs and Autonomous Bodies under Department of School Education & Literacy. This collaborative effort resulted in enthusiastic participation of more than 52 lakh students, teachers and stakeholders.

Various activities like special assemblies, essay, poetry and painting competitions, screening of short films and stories recounting the valour of the Sahibzades were held in schools across the country. A digital exhibition detailing the life story and sacrifice of the Sahibzades was also displayed.

Ministry of Education in collaboration with MyGov also organised an interactive online quiz curated by CBSE which saw the participation of more than 1.3 lakh people nationwide. Students acquainted themselves with the inspiring lives and noble deeds of Sahibzadas.

 

Smt. Annpurna Devi, Hon'ble Minister of State for Education, participated in the quiz on 'Veer BaalDiwas 2023’.
